Torrent Pharma Q1 net up 65 pc
Ahmedabad, July 31 (UNI) City-based pharma major Torrent Pharmaceuticals has reported a 65 per cent rise in consolidated net profit for the quarter ended June 30 at Rs 27 crore as against Rs 16 crore during the corresponding quarter last year.
Consolidated operating profits (PBDIT) for Q1 went up by 29 per cent to Rs 44 crore compared to Rs 34 crore in previous quarter, a company press release here said.
The company has reported an 11 per cent rise in consolidated sales at Rs 331 crore for the quarter ended June 30 compared to Rs 299 crore in the corresponding quarter of the last fiscal.
Consolidated international sales stood at Rs 129 crore, a 5 per cent rise over the corresponding period last fiscal, according to a company press release.
The domestic formulation business registered sales of Rs 172 crore as against Rs 148 crore during the corresponding quarter last year, registering a 16 per cent growth. Adjusting for the effect of sales spillover due to implementation of VAT in eight states in Q1 of previous year, the domestic formulation sales grew by 22 per cent during the quarter. This growth rate was largely due to buoyant performance in diabetology and cardiology divisions and increasing market share of new products introduced in the previous year, the release said.
Production for domestic market in the new facility in Himachal Pradesh continued to bolster margins for the quarter due to fiscal benefits by way of excise duty exemption and lower income tax, the release said.
During the quarter, Brazilian operations clocked a slower growth of 19 per cent with sales of Rs 37 crores, up from Rs 31 crore last quarter.
In the German market, which faces severe price erosions, Heumann grew by 5 per cent to Rs 59 crore compared to Rs 56 crore. Price erosions are expected to continue going forward which will be offset with a time-lag through reduced manufacturing costs by shifting manufacturing to India plants, restructuring of operations to reduce SGA and volume expansion, the release said.
